Avant-garde composer of 4'33" John Cage would've been 100 years old today and events marking the occasion are taking place all over the world.

The 100th birthday of famed avant-garde composer John Cage would have been today. To mark the occasion, various events are taking place across the world to honour the composer of the experimental classic 4'33".

The Sage, Gateshead will be hosting a theatrical even entitled 'A Dinner Party With John Cage', which is to include 'opera, folksong, wine glasses, chopsticks, politics and gibberish', while East London venue The Macbeth is will be holding a special concert of Cage works tomorrow.

The East London concert, hosted by the Nonclassical club night, will feature innovative performances of key Cage works, including the famous 4'33".

Elsewhere, concerts and celebrations are happening in New York, Seattle and LA, while Berlin will play host to several pieces in their annual music festival. Cage died 20 years previously, just days before premiering new works for a celebration of his work in the German capital.
